Output 80909de05ba3b040de3a19aba7f7a648811932acf6df7d067b42212fc51a6d4b:0

value
17578183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68f73fef26c59b1152170bd8e28e58003a2262d8 OP_EQUAL
address
3BG2Phz37WLUregKoAeTrqMFF7JfuNtMt7
transaction
80909de05ba3b040de3a19aba7f7a648811932acf6df7d067b42212fc51a6d4b
spent
true